Ответ:
x=-b/2a
Step-by-step explanation:
axis of symmetry is the line that across the vertex from a parabola(ax^2+bx+c).
The expression to find vertex is -b/2a
Thus, x=-b/2a is a vertical line that across the vertex aka the axis of symmetry.
